From nobody Mon Feb 9 10:27:16 2026 Delivered-To: importer@patchew.org Authentication-Results: m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=qemu-devel-bounces+importer=patchew.org@nongnu.org; dmarc=pass(p=none dis=none) header.from=gmail.com ARC-Seal: i=1; a=rsa-sha256; t=1770557420; cv=none; d=zohomail.com; s=zohoarc; b=OSZgdgq4Fb6sjsgVgQ8eZRzkFmcBPqx2xKWWl0FDAe1py9XaVJwswnNi4Qz+t9RqcPkq3e2OLR+hWag+M44UmQL7bOSMVEbUc3M3k2zKuHfyWBRhjoJM6q4jr0UKqT5Tfs7OrPBqXXbfLM++ELiF2syRU4fIYTtNR5G9A2kNUEQ= 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=zohomail.com; s=zohoarc; t=1770557420; h=Content-Transfer-Encoding:Cc:Cc:Date:Date:From:From:List-Subscribe:List-Post:List-Id:List-Archive:List-Help:List-Unsubscribe:MIME-Version:Message-ID:Sender:Subject:Subject:To:To:Message-Id:Reply-To; bh=hVaj8lSk2x+ox2BqGp0oGSbNfcP5O7ZC/H0c7Il1T4I=; b=FPOX6PfrTPrnGsNGnqD+aYDVSjrqeJdGRNcrnUboAxJ3qKRFC+tFsIUgUrwAestwduO+MT3m9hwbsEfogVFJUJKzuIVTQ9YuFYIpy9rVZUztPOQEJm/61Oj642n0sRhauug0YC4Qp63Qf5jlbexFWRxqNdkUPM/iylnwhZw33AU= ARC-Authentication-Results: i=1; m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=qemu-devel-bounces+importer=patchew.org@nongnu.org; dmarc=pass header.from= (p=none dis=none) Return-Path: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) by mx.zohomail.com with SMTPS id 1770557420896190.10235964062122; Sun, 8 Feb 2026 05:30:20 -0800 (PST)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1vp4r0-0005q9-8G; Sun, 08 Feb 2026 08:29:35 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1vp4qq-0005pK-EY for qemu-devel@nongnu.org; Sun, 08 Feb 2026 08:29:24 -0500 Received: from mail-pj1-x1031.google.com ([2607:f8b0:4864:20::1031]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1vp4qo-0001Hw-LI for qemu-devel@nongnu.org; Sun, 08 Feb 2026 08:29:24 -0500 Received: by mail-pj1-x1031.google.com with SMTP id 98e67ed59e1d1-3562258142fso477842a91.3 for ; Sun, 08 Feb 2026 05:29:22 -0800 (PST) Received: from localhost ([2409:40e2:1008:bc1d:9205:403a:2318:6cbc]) by smtp.gmail.com with ESMTPSA id 98e67ed59e1d1-354b2253c70sm8003747a91.17.2026.02.08.05.29.18 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sun, 08 Feb 2026 05:29:19 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1770557360; x=1771162160; darn=nongnu.org;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:from:to:cc:subject:date:message-id:reply-to; bh=hVaj8lSk2x+ox2BqGp0oGSbNfcP5O7ZC/H0c7Il1T4I=; b=jcf689p7E1UV7SWkyK70toDilgFLyACrVs6Z4/Wqvg1Q1/G9dSr+fPbMTx2AERcGhB IKe95DYEpG9tKkdBkHL9PEdpwBavnyBuw8OluTmBfATyiAUnWxYnaZoGVGzdOEsVTGnE ZRGqdVxkLDWTKZ/WlZUq1uIv3DxQ+zHnVItmEz7JJYR4/nHPwU6PD/+syg8OFvYi+o9T tXjuhj+S8eWSVGQW8qmhuuvE1/WlyI6dGcVISfGkPSkudH80UxXf84CSIeRPatjI6mEh mUS1eZMfq4vVsNa6+RxWBaCM43B5rwIrr/xkIu24rAsjZuzbcBOK7aouDTpeS0QyRN8Q AE/g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1770557360; x=1771162160; h=content-transfer-encoding:mime-version:message-id:date:subject:cc :to:from:x-gm-gg: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=hVaj8lSk2x+ox2BqGp0oGSbNfcP5O7ZC/H0c7Il1T4I=; b=osU/P2F24nkdoQ7wrYwYWUwA9eY8J45LL2mTMKJFGK48uJcryqqu/FGoz9Om83dZrX KSqka5WVIT8IUJ4si2NAeiri0h40zKZdxBXeAo/ESHPgdR/aFq25mKXSbLGhBADwW2YZ 4mlXwQYAr01Kn8XKyjld7CUZwn0Qlq2JCRTNE7+HrT2Vcm8L/8La+AEd5ukeUUNcp94o z9FMSIK6Rk01wDQQhaXA2D3uE5gRyUsB6Kjhb0e96rrf+ljZqLS0tYYJskZ29KeLHOko 6YxvuUyChxh29LRhXWg/ciCnXDJb4QWzwF9z3mDmMU2a6u8F2qZOKlsnJ3E8VMi6D6Qi HkCw== X-Gm-Message-State: AOJu0YyMRpeIHolqima+yf0vwYqXViupJDtScxxY7z4XD5EeaeZg7855 b4mG3D2Q1BcDED80E2GKHaQQ3Vg7Kx0+l9hk9jMMY0CLKABqZz6FgUCVqYhehzkd5JdS1g== X-Gm-Gg: AZuq6aIj+aQm003m+Jb/O+l6hkqSgjQvYfkIWUw3MEnsD7qkbNVO/TxAjmepmnDZD6j fCHdv/PaL8ku0R7qHDZZTddGEGL/ejUaYERtiJi7MUlkCHDxtTqUVx7T1CntEo1Pk5cNsYrRO9a WKllhUKqUaw4zb9YmYg2OUOVURTBfmM9qFFCl4nOuwOdKGZiBDrNTglTyXSSCAMowcLR6crYi9I 3bL9jhTojX353sOA0dyIvuTC2UjUAk59iCIIjjbj6PcB1307tgJKH2P47+R4S2cPwe0nSSpgzWD N72iRZl8z465K8xexT1h/n1Aju0MnFeCH8yDDA4NjVwnevW8m2WV6J48fMaTfkilVwxdKUTPrpP R4ygN5KdGl5Ei2QRgs9wV0Kg0zYLRbs/iDzWRvIDZbq8IXL0BYoynXTj3fj+NCC+o8x+VfE01B5 bl8zk1TZSwQzoOMFjLx9QrqoSWVJvADyLhv1YQ5uM7+FQQN6Lfw64oM9mMwx9IhPYviO/ucqSEw YGmMRB68NTW+MWj7Qpau2bIbDpN9dRgd4RJ7gysPCvni2nZIg== X-Received: by 2002:a17:90b:1d85:b0:353:49f2:1e7a with SMTP id 98e67ed59e1d1-354b3e2be90mr8213515a91.17.1770557360449; Sun, 08 Feb 2026 05:29:20 -0800 (PST) From: "Manish." To: qemu-devel@nongnu.org Cc: Max Filippov , "Manish." Subject: [PATCH] hw/xtensa: convert calloc to g_new0 in mx_pic.c Date: Sun, 8 Feb 2026 18:59:13 +0530 Message-ID: <20260208132913.41498-1-manishyoudumb@gmail.com> X-Mailer: git-send-email 2.52.0 MIME-Version: 1.0 Content-Transfer-Encoding: quoted-printable Received-SPF: pass (zohomail.com: domain of gnu.org designates 209.51.188.17 as permitted sender) client-ip=209.51.188.17; envelope-from=qemu-devel-bounces+importer=patchew.org@nongnu.org; helo=lists.gnu.org; Received-SPF: pass client-ip=2607:f8b0:4864:20::1031; envelope-from=manishyoudumb@gmail.com; helo=mail-pj1-x1031.google.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: qemu-devel@nongn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: qemu development List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: qemu-devel-bounces+importer=patchew.org@nongnu.org Sender: qemu-devel-bounces+importer=patchew.org@nongnu.org X-ZohoMail-DKIM: pass (identity @gmail.com) X-ZM-MESSAGEID: 1770557423828154100 Content-Type: text/plain; charset="utf-8" Convert the calloc allocation in xtensa_mx_pic_init() to use g_new0() for consistency. Resolves: https://gitlab.com/qemu-project/qemu/-/issues/1798 Signed-off-by: Manish. --- hw/xtensa/mx_pic.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/hw/xtensa/mx_pic.c b/hw/xtensa/mx_pic.c index 07c3731aef..ab308c9490 100644 --- a/hw/xtensa/mx_pic.c +++ b/hw/xtensa/mx_pic.c @@ -316,8 +316,7 @@ static void xtensa_mx_pic_set_irq(void *opaque, int irq= , int active) =20 XtensaMxPic *xtensa_mx_pic_init(unsigned n_irq) { - XtensaMxPic *mx =3D calloc(1, sizeof(XtensaMxPic)); - + XtensaMxPic *mx =3D g_new0(XtensaMxPic, 1); mx->n_irq =3D n_irq + 1; mx->irq_inputs =3D qemu_allocate_irqs(xtensa_mx_pic_set_irq, mx, mx->n_irq); --=20 2.52.0